We train enterprising, competitive and humanistic professionals who manage their activity in an organized manner, as an important axis within the strengthening of the country's productive system, generating programs and projects that articulate the public and private sectors to guarantee the Development Plan based on progress. sustainable and positioning of Ecuador as a quality tourist destination. The future professionals of this career will be able to carry out in managerial positions of supervision and operation, in the different areas of the tourist activity. Graduate profile includes: Organizes and integrates knowledge, identifying up-to-date and specialized concepts and theories of their training; Develops, analyzes and evaluates the quality of resources, services, ecosystems and their components, through applied research processes, for the positioning of destinations that intervene in the dynamics of the economy that improves the standard of living of the community through tourist activity; Includes in its professional work respect for the execution of current policy and legislation; Has knowledge about social, cultural, economic, political aspects of the community, which allows him to manage innovative projects both public and private for the development of destinations; Handles principles of sustainability of sensitive natural areas through interpretation and environmental education, recognizes respects and values ​​ancestral knowledge, the patrimonial wealth of the country and recognizes its own identity; and Knows the components of the tourism system through observation and characterizes the tourism systems, through tourism operation techniques, management and entrepreneurship and research complying with sustainability standards.

Admission Requirements

All required documents (in digital copy; pdf format) are to be submitted to the university. Applicants to enter the Tourism Career in virtual mode must meet the following entry profile: Know the fundamental principles of basic science and tourism; Have communication skills in different languages ​​and languages; Have skills for human relations and decision making to solve problems of tourist activity; Capacities to adapt to responsible tourism activities; Have a vocation for the provision of tourist services, being proactive, assertive with leadership traits, participatory and supportive; and Demonstrate self-preparation and interest in their professional training from the systemic study, research and acceptance of social, technological, environmental and economic changes.
